What is Document Fraud Detection?

Document fraud detection refers to the systematic process of identifying false or altered documents intended for deceptive purposes. This process plays a critical role in numerous sectors, including finance, insurance, and government. Examples of fraudulent documents include fake identification, manipulated financial statements, and counterfeit contracts. Advanced document fraud detection techniques leverage cutting-edge technology to analyze data and apply algorithms, making it easier to identify discrepancies that suggest fraud.

Common Types of Document Fraud

Document fraud can take multiple forms, with each type posing unique challenges. Some of the most common include:

  • Counterfeit Documents: Completely fake documents created to mimic legitimate ones.
  • Altered Documents: Legitimate documents that have been modified to present false information.
  • Forged Signatures: Unauthorized signatures added to documents to mislead stakeholders.
  • Stolen Identity Documents: Documents that use stolen identities to conduct fraudulent activities.

Technologies Used in Document Fraud Detection

AI and Machine Learning Applications

Artificial intelligence (AI) and machine learning (ML) are at the forefront of document fraud detection. These technologies analyze vast amounts of data quickly and accurately, learning from patterns of legitimate versus fraudulent documents. AI algorithms can identify inconsistencies in document formats, text, and images, significantly increasing detection rates while minimizing false positives. This technological advancement allows organizations to respond to threats more proactively.

Measuring the Effectiveness of Document Fraud Detection

Key Performance Indicators to Monitor

To gauge the success of a document fraud detection system, organizations should track several key performance indicators (KPIs), including:

  • Detection Rate: The percentage of fraudulent documents detected compared to total documents analyzed.
  • False Positive Rate: The frequency of legitimate documents flagged as fraudulent.
  • Response Time: The time taken to analyze and verify documents upon submission.
  • Cost Savings: The monetary savings achieved by reducing fraud incidents.

Can you run a fraud check on PDF documents?

Yes, many fraud detection tools can analyze PDF documents to verify their authenticity. These tools evaluate the structure, metadata, and content of PDFs to detect alterations or signs of forgery.
